A giant leap forward in RF integration, the TDA827x features an embedded
low noise input amplifier and an image rejection mixer for processing RF
signals and downconverting to low IF signals, which are then filtered before
being sent to the channel decoder or IF demodulator. It offers optimal
partitioning of functions at the system level, removing the need for both
SAW filters or IF amplifiers.
This family also features a fully integrated VCO that has no external tank
component, an RF splitter with two separate outputs and an RSSI signal
indicator embedded on the IC. All this integration results in very low power
consumption for the TDA827x, removing the need for an external heat sink
and further simplifying design-in efforts.
A complete family
The TDA827x family is a complete range of silicon tuners, featuring dedicated
devices for a wide range of applications:
TDA8270HN: US STB or cable modem applications
TDA8271HN: Rest of the world STB and cable modem applications
TDA8274HN: Multi standard STB and cable modem applications

Common features
Real Silicon tuner approach: only 30 SMD components
for the Bill of Material (BOM)
Wideband low noise RF amplifier with AGC
Integrated and Programmable Selectivity
RF splitter with 2 separate outputs (-2 / +6 dB)
RF filter
Image rejection mixer stage
Fully integrated VCO
RSSI signal indicator, +/- 0.5 dB relative accuracy
(3 dB absolute value), no calibration needed
ntegrated 16 MHz crystal oscillator and output buffer
to channel decoder or other tuner
I2C bus controlled
Temperature range: -20 to + 70°C
Power: 3.3V, 1.29 W (typical)
Package: MLF 40 pins 6 x 6 mm HVQFN40
